To provide a bathroom chair which facilitates operation of unlocking a seat locked by a locking device by operating an unlocking operation device in an easy posture without needing stooping down.
The bathroom chair includes a leg 1, a seat 2, and a back rest 3, and the seat 2 is mounted to the leg 1 turnably between a horizontal state and a state of being turned upward to be folded. The locking device 4 which locks the horizontally turned seat 2 to the leg 1 and holds the same horizontally is provided. The unlocking operation device 5 which performs operation of unlocking the seat locked by the locking device 4 is provided at the back rest 3. The unlocking operation device 5 provided at the back rest 3 provided at the high position of the chair can be operated keeping an easily standing posture without needing stooping down.
